First impression - I like it. I adjusted the brightness lower, from default 100 down to 30.
As a computer monitor, the 1920 x 1080 native mode looks crisp for 2D, with 3D glasses off.
When connected to the Sony HDR-TD10 via HDMI, must set the TD10 to output SBS mode for 3D. Frame pack mode doesn't produce a correct image. Can view both playback and live camera through the monitor in 3D.
RealD 3D glasses from the theater work.
I have the monitor face tilt set so that with one tilt setting 3D looks correct when sitting at normal monitor distance of approx 3 feet or when standing about 9 feet away.
PC - The "Tridef 3d" software that comes with the monitor certainly shows off the 3D. Stills and videos in 3D provided on that CD disk look great, like Disneyworld 3D. This included player in the monitor pkg will not play my MVC 3D files from the TD10 in actual 3D like the monitor does when I directly connect it via HDMI to the TD10 camcorder playback.
I have an SBS mode 3D segment from the animated "Chicken Little" that I played in 3D using the freeware VLC player by selecting the 3D mode on the monitor. Looks good. 3D both pops out of the monitor and has depth. Images are bright.

The "Tridef 3D" package was not needed to play in 3D the SBS format 3D file segment I tried. I used VLC video player, with no special drivers and no particular 3D setup to play in 3D an SBS file.
Also the Sony HD10 camcorder displayed 3D in SBS mode when directly connected to this monitor.
The SBS mode of 3D is selected from the LG D2342P monitor menu. In this mode, the monitor interprets the input signal as an SBS mode 3D signal, and arranges the display so that the passive 3D mode works.
This means that the monitor will play 3D content from any video player for SBS mode media. Though I have not tried it, I suspect it would work in SBS mode with Mac, Linux, and other 3D camcorders where the content source was SBS. It also has an option for top / bottom mode which I have not tried yet.
Other 3D I have seen on this monitor where while connected to the PS3. The PS3 recognized it as a 23" 3D capable monitor. I downloaded several free 3D game demos and 3D movie demos from the Play Station Network. These 3D demos looked excellent on the monitor.
I read that PS3 3D movies that are not from bluray are in MP4 "frame alternate" mode.

The manual is correct for only being able to select SBS 3D when using the HDMI input connection on the D2342P.
The video card for all my testing done thus far only has a DVI-D output and no HDMI. When I used a DVI to DVI input on the D2342P monitor, I could not select SBS. So I switched to using a DVI to hdmi cable, going to the monitor's HDMI input. That input connection allowed the SBS selection through the front panel menu buttons on the D2342P. All of my 3D testing since then has been via the HDMI input on the D2342P monitor.
I have not used the L/R change option.
The front panel menu allows selecting 2D mode of display, though when an SBS signal is input to the monitor in the monitor's 2D mode, the two side by side images appear on the monitor.

Here's how I have mine adjusted for optimum 3D. I used the adjustment screen and 3D still photos in the tridef3d software that came with the monitor to minimize ghosting and maximize detail.
With my nose aligned with the center of the screen 28" away, the face of the monitor is tilted (using the adjustment of the stock mount) so that the top edge of the monitor is 3" further away from me than the bottom edge is. I used a level and ruler to measure this to reply to your question.
I was looking through the manual again last night, and think I found the answer to my question. It specifically mentions a 12 degree vertical viewing angle. At first I thought that there was a 12 degree range for optimal viewing, but when I looked more closely at the diagram, it seems it actually means that the optimal viewing angle is exactly 12 degrees off axis. The diagram shows the monitor tilted back that much, which pretty much matches my experience. I assume the odd angle is just a requirement of this particular technology.

With VLC, I used an SBS 3D Panasonic demo file. It has video in 1920 x 1080 format containing SBS left & right eye images, so that the image for each eye is 960x1080. I made the selection for 3D SBS in the monitor menu. VLC did not perform any 3D conversion process. VLC simply output L & R image together, and the monitor converted it for 3D viewing.
With Sony Vegas 10d I did a still 3D photo capture with a selection of SBS 3840 x 1080 of a frame from my Sony TD10 camcorder file. I then used the PowerDVD 11 software to output line interlaced 3D mode, and PowerDVD did the conversion from full SBS to line interlaced. I say that PowerDVD did the conversion since I do not need to set the monitor to SBS mode, and the 3D image appears whether I set to "line interlaced 3D" mode, or let the monitor select the mode. I have not tried this with video yet, only 3840 x 1080 still SBS images, though it should work with video if PowerDVD 11 allows that.
